Creative Work in English
It was great to see Abigail in 7 Willow arrive at school today with a great creation that she had made to support her learning in English this term on Greek Mythology.
She had made a Minotaur out of clay and used silver beads to create the figure as well as a maze – the beads enabling the minotaur to track its way through the maze.
It is all part of an English project arranged by Advanced Lead Teacher and English Leader Miss Denton as part of an imaginative Greek mythology project to start the year off at Bushey Meads with a bang.
